c++ - Can't Clean Box2D from my Eclipse Android Project -
i new eclipse/android. have cocos2d-x project , have added box2d based on responses http://www.cocos2d-x.org/boards/6/topics/20827.
when project/clean/(clean projects) get
clean: box2d_static [armeabi]
rm -rf (target_objs)
/bin/sh: -c: line 0: syntax error near unexpected token `('
i haven't been able find rm -rf (target_objs) line in shell scripts, have no idea error coming from.
my hunch may mixing copy of box2d source in project copy in cocos2d-x home folder.
here full build output, followed android.mk project.
11:19:03 ** clean-only build of configuration default project racerx ** bash /users/paul/projects/racerx/proj.android/build_native.sh ndk_debug=1 v=1 clean
ndk_root = /users/paul/tools/android-ndk-r8e
cocos2dx_root = /users/paul/tools/cocos2d-x-2.1.4
app_root = /users/paul/projects/racerx/proj.android/..
app_android_root = /users/paul/projects/racerx/proj.android
using prebuilt externals
make: entering directory `/users/paul/projects/racerx/proj.android'
clean: box2d_static [armeabi]
rm -rf (target_objs)
/bin/sh: -c: line 0: syntax error near unexpected token `('
make: leaving directory `/users/paul/projects/racerx/proj.android'
/bin/sh: -c: line 0: `rm -rf (target_objs)'
make: * [clean-box2d_static-armeabi] error 2
11:19:03 build finished (took 481ms)
my android.mk:
local_path := $(call my-dir)
include $(clear_vars)
local_module := game_shared
local_module_filename := libgame
local_src_files := hellocpp/main.cpp \ ../../classes/bike.cpp \ ../../classes/terrain.cpp \ ../../classes/appdelegate.cpp \ ../../classes/worldlayer.cpp \ ../../classes/gles-render.cpp
local_c_includes := $(local_path)/../../classes \ ../racerx/libs/box2d
local_whole_static_libraries := cocos2dx_static cocosdenshion_static cocos_extension_static box2d_static include $(build_shared_library)
$(call import-module,cocosdenshion/android) \ $(call import-module,cocos2dx) \ $(call import-module,external/box2d) \ $(call import-module,extensions)
Comments
Post a Comment